The project will build an interchange consisting of a grade separation at both Slaughter Lane and La Crosse Avenue. Following an environmental study, it was decided a diverging diamond intersection would be added at Slaughter, and a traditional diamond intersection would be added at La Crosse. An underpass will also be constructed allowing MoPac to go under Slaughter and La Crosse. In August the construction contract was awarded to Webber LLC.

Timeline: construction will begin in early 2018, expected to be complete in mid- to late 2020
Cost: $536 million
Funding source: TxDOT
